About the role
Description supplied by the original job listing.
As a Senior Release Engineer, you will be responsible for delivering software releases and optimizing our release processes. You will work closely with the engineering team to streamline software deployment, enhance CI/CD pipelines, and ensure smooth releases. Your expertise will be critical in maintaining reliability, efficiency, and automation in our release workflows. Our customers range from seed-stage startups to Fortune 500 enterprises.
Responsibilities:
Develop and maintain release deployment pipelines.
Optimize the release process to ensure smooth and efficient deployments.
Manage and enhance CI/CD pipelines using CircleCI and GitHub Actions.
Work with Git to manage branching strategies, resolve conflicts, and enforce best practices.
Automate release tasks using Python and Linux scripting.
Troubleshoot and resolve issues related to software releases and deployments.
Utilize Docker for containerization, including multi-stage builds for optimizing image sizes.
Coordinate with developers and the QA team for release instructions, versions, release verification tests, and troubleshooting release blockers.
Enhance and enforce security, compliance, and stability in release workflows.
Proactively identify inefficiencies and automate manual processes to enhance release efficiency.
Implement monitoring and rollback strategies for releases to mitigate risks.
Document release processes, best practices, and deployment strategies.
Requirements:
Minimum 5 years of experience in release engineering, DevOps, or a related role.
At least 4 years of proficiency in Python to understand the existing codebase and resolve conflicts during the release process.
At least 2 years of hands-on experience with Docker, including multi-stage builds and optimization techniques.
Strong proficiency in Git, including branching strategies, cherry-picking commits, conflict resolution, and related operations.
Experience working with CI/CD tools such as CircleCI and GitHub Actions.
Knowledge of semantic versioning and best practices for version control.
Expertise in Linux scripting for automation and troubleshooting.
Strong troubleshooting skills for debugging release-related issues.
Strong collaboration and communication skills to work with cross-functional teams.
